Introduction

I am using seven numerical tables to create this Mathematical Trick. I found the idea of this trick in my old papers but I don't remember from which book or magazine I read it before. I confess that my work is a translation of this idea to a VB6 program.

Background

  • Choose number from 1 to 100, keep it in your mind.
  • I shall display (7) tables.
  • Every table contains some numbers.
  • Search for the number of your choice in every table.
  • If you find it: Click (Yes) button.
  • If not: Click (No) button.
  • After displaying last table (number 7):
  • I shall tell you your choice number!

Using the Code

The following code is an example to fill MSFlexGrid with numbers:

Dim c As Integer
Dim r As Integer
Dim n As Integer
Dim T As Integer

   With NumGrid
      T = 1
      For r = 0 To 4
         For c = 0 To 9
            .TextMatrix(r, c) = Str(T)
            T = T + 2
         Next c
      Next r

Please refer to the source code (Sub FillTab) to see how I fill the grid with numbers seven times.
